Description
The J2ME release of Command & Conquer 4: Tiberian Twilight mimicks the general gameplay of its computer-based counterpart in that it too discards the standard real-time strategy gameplay in favour of real-time tactics. One of the differences is that Crawlers do not need to deploy to construct units, but due to the smaller scale of mobile hardware at the time, unit population caps were even lower than in the Windows version.
There are 6 missions for GDI and 6 missions for Nod, and what little plot there is is separate from the storyline in the Windows release.
